During the boom years of real estate in Florida, the major
developers built thousands of housing units that were beyond
the reach of most of the people who live in this state – tiny
condos that cost more than $400 a square foot for
“international investors,” luxurious McMansions near the water
for people from “up north,” gated communities miles away from
the city centers whose residents become slaves of their cars
the day they move into their new suburb.  (We long for the days
of our youth when we walked to the store for a loaf of bread or
milk, instead of having to get in a car.)  The motto for the
teachers, firemen, nurses and policemen who wanted a home
– “Drive until you qualify” – started to ring hollow when gas
reached $3 a gallon.

This real estate cycle has burst, but not the price of homes.  
Many essential members of this community – the people who
provide the core services that we all need to make Florida feel
like home – are still not capable of realizing the American
dream of home ownership.  The people we need to make our
communities viable are picking up and leaving Florida, as
evidence by the fact that school enrollment has begun to shrink.
